You have to feel a bit for Jim Calhoun: the guy's been getting hammered lately. No, not the NCAA, but injuries.
Calhoun broke a hip on his bike Saturday and will have surgery. Not easy for anyone, but the man is 70 and his health has not been good.
He has had a previous bike accident, a couple of bouts with cancer, and missed the end of last season with spinal stenosis.
We admire his determination to continue coaching, but there comes a time when it's okay to just let it go.
